Understanding the cost components is crucial. Shipping costs can initially seem straightforward, but they’re subject to numerous variables. For instance, the pricing structure often hinges on package dimensions, weight, and the desired speed of delivery. A standard parcel might cost $5 in domestic shipping, whereas international destinations can push costs to three times that amount or more, depending on destination and delivery speed. An example to consider: during peak seasons like Christmas, these costs can escalate by up to 20% due to increased demand and limited capacity.

Speed is another factor to consider. Everyone loves next-day delivery, but efficient logistics management seeks to balance cost against speed. Offering expedited shipping options—like overnight or two-day services—means higher costs, not just for the customer but also for handling, prioritization, and route optimization. Efficient logistics plans often incorporate a strategy like zone skipping, a method where packages destined for a common region are grouped, sorted, and shipped together. This approach reduces sorting times and cuts down costs by 10% to 20%, enhancing delivery speed without compromising on service quality.

A critical component of logistics involves selecting the right carrier. Companies like FedEx, UPS, and DHL have varying strengths. For instance, FedEx is known for its overnight shipping prowess, making it a viable option for rapid delivery needs. On the other hand, USPS might excel in cost-effectiveness, particularly for lightweight packages. Making the right choice involves evaluating shipping contracts, customer reviews, and service guarantees. It’s not uncommon for logistics managers to shift carrier alliances based on performance metrics gathered over quarterly reviews.

Warehousing sits at the heart of logistics. The location and management of warehouses play a significant role in how quickly products reach the end-user. Strategically located warehouses reduce lead times and shipping costs. A decentralized network of warehouses can give a service edge, cutting delivery times from a week to mere days. Amazon’s success with its Prime shipping service is due in part to its vast and strategically located network of fulfillment centers across the globe, which ensures that 95% of its US customers have access to two-day delivery.

To streamline operations, adopting technology is indispensable. Tracking software and real-time data analytics are invaluable for monitoring the progress of shipments and identifying bottlenecks. Data transparency isn’t just about efficiency; it builds consumer trust. Customers today expect to track their packages from the warehouse to their doorstep. Systems like RFID and GPS tracking are instrumental in providing this transparency, cutting down inquiry calls by as much as 30%. Insurance coverage is essential in logistics, safeguarding against potential losses during transit. Insurance not only covers the financial value but also ensures reputation protection. For instance, when dealing with high-value items, having comprehensive insurance can prevent significant financial setbacks due to unforeseen circumstances like theft or damage.

Efficient logistics also include understanding the legal frameworks. International shipping involves compliance with a myriad of regulations, tariffs, and duties. An oversight in this domain can cause costly delays. An example: the trade war tariffs introduced by the US on Chinese goods impacted shipping dynamics significantly, adding unforeseen costs and requiring companies to reassess their sourcing and logistics strategies.

Engaging in sustainable practices aligns with modern consumer values and can impact logistics efficacy positively. Choosing eco-friendly packaging reduces waste and may help access markets with stringent environmental regulations, like the European Union’s packaging waste directive, setting an example for responsible logistics management.

Communicating with customers remains a crucial aspect of logistics management. Keeping customers informed about potential delays, changes in delivery schedules, or any disruption helps in managing expectations and maintaining customer satisfaction. A noteworthy reference is how Zappos, an online shoe retailer, excels in customer service by ensuring proactive communication, thus equating its logistical competency with its reputation for delightful customer experiences.

In planning for scalability, logistics needs to account for growth projections, market expansion plans, and even unexpected surges in demand. Incorporating flexible contracts with carriers and maintaining scalable warehousing options provide a buffer against demand fluctuations, demonstrating forward-thinking management practices.

Tools such as delivery management software optimize the last-mile delivery process, where products reach the customer’s door. This step is often the most challenging in terms of logistics, as it represents up to 53% of the total shipping cost. Innovations in this area, such as autonomous delivery drones or bots, although not yet widespread, signal the future direction of efficiency in logistics.
